Impulsive wave A term used in the Elliott wave theory to describe the strong move in a stock’s price coinciding with the main direction of the underlying trend. These impulse waves are shown in the illustration below as wave 1, wave 3 and wave 5. Impulse waves also refer to the strong downward movements in a downtrend. Impulsive wave
